Output 85fb3c65378590ef31490994e0f9c951f929ce255fde2574f4335ef170051058:4

value
126509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96c8330c917aabb9a5de8114aab231de39e09e7b OP_EQUAL
address
3FSH7R9nPwxFGbCg2mgg5ycZAQ4wjGvGpw
transaction
85fb3c65378590ef31490994e0f9c951f929ce255fde2574f4335ef170051058
spent
true